Once an individual comes to terms with the reality that they need help to resolve drug addiction, the next action is choosing the appropriate drug rehab for them. Some drug treatment programs don't call for any form of inpatient stay and supply services on an outpatient basis for instance. At this type of drug rehab the person receives treatment through the day and returns home in the evening. While this kind of drug rehab may seem convenient, it will not present the ideal treatment environment for somebody who desires to step away from drug influences and other circumstances which could compromise one's sobriety. The most confirmed and helpful treatment settings are those which call for an inpatient or residential stay, so that the person can concentrate entirely on bettering themselves and healing from addiction, not on every day distractions and drug addiction triggers.

For instance, someone or some circumstance in one's environment could be the precise trigger of one's drug use. If the particular person returns to this each day while in drug rehab, all gains will be lost and most will typically relapse. There are also various lengths of stay even in inpatient and residential drug rehabilitation programs, with treatment curriculums varying from 30 days to up to a year for some. As a rule of thumb, somebody who is set on resolving addiction problems once and for all should stay in drug rehab as long as it takes. A month in treatment is barely enough time to even recuperate physically from continual substance abuse. A substantial amount of time is needed, even months in some cases, to benefit from intensive therapy and other treatment tools to heal psychologically and emotionally so that one can actually make a fresh start once treatment is complete.
